University of Central Arkansas

About University

The University of Central Arkansas (UCA) is a public university located in Conway, Arkansas. Established in 1907, UCA has grown to become one of the leading institutions in the state, known for its commitment to academic excellence, community engagement, and student success. The university offers a diverse range of undergraduate, graduate, and doctoral programs across various fields of study, including arts, sciences, business, education, and health professions. UCA is dedicated to providing a supportive and inclusive environment for its students, fostering a culture of learning and innovation. The campus is equipped with state-of-the-art facilities, including modern classrooms, research labs, and recreational centers, ensuring a comprehensive educational experience. UCA also emphasizes the importance of extracurricular activities, offering numerous student organizations, clubs, and athletic programs to enhance personal growth and leadership skills. With a strong focus on research and community service, UCA encourages students to engage in projects that address real-world challenges, preparing them for successful careers and meaningful contributions to society.

The University of Central Arkansas is recognized for its quality education and has been ranked among the top regional universities in the South by U.S. News & World Report. While it may not be ranked globally, UCA is known for its strong academic programs, dedicated faculty, and commitment to student success, making it a respected institution within the region.
The University of Central Arkansas offers a variety of career services to support students and alumni in their professional development. These services include career counseling, resume workshops, job fairs, and networking events. UCA's strong connections with local and regional employers provide students with valuable internship and job opportunities, helping them to gain practical experience and build successful careers in their chosen fields.
UCA provides a range of scholarships to support students financially, including merit-based, need-based, and departmental scholarships. The university also offers scholarships for international students and those involved in specific programs or activities. Students are encouraged to apply for scholarships through the UCA Foundation and explore external scholarship opportunities to help fund their education.
International students planning to study at UCA must obtain an F-1 student visa. The university's International Engagement Office assists students with the visa application process, providing guidance on required documentation, SEVIS registration, and maintaining visa status. Students are advised to apply for their visa well in advance of their intended start date to ensure a smooth transition to studying in the United States.
